When diagnosing a rough idle in a 2013 Mercedes-Benz E400, it's essential to adopt a systematic diagnostic approach that prioritizes simpler checks before delving into more complex issues. Start by using a diagnostic scanner to check for any fault codes, as these can quickly point you to specific problems within the vehicle's systems. Next, inspect the spark plugs for wear or fouling, as these components play a crucial role in engine performance. A clean air filter is also vital; ensure it is free from clogs that could restrict airflow. Following this, examine the fuel system, including the fuel filter and injectors, to confirm that fuel delivery is optimal. Don't overlook the vacuum hoses; any leaks or damage here can significantly impact engine idle. Additionally, inspect the throttle body for carbon buildup, which can obstruct airflow and affect idle quality. Finally, consider performing a smoke test to identify any vacuum leaks in the intake system. By following this structured approach, you can effectively diagnose and resolve the rough idle issue in your E400, ensuring a smoother driving experience.
When diagnosing a rough idle in your 2013 Mercedes-Benz E400, it's essential to consider several common problems that could be affecting your vehicle's performance. One of the primary culprits is a dirty or faulty mass airflow sensor, which can disrupt the delicate balance of air and fuel entering the engine. Additionally, vacuum leaks can create an improper air-fuel mixture, leading to instability during idle. It's also crucial to inspect the spark plugs and ignition coils, as worn components can cause misfires that contribute to a rough idle. A clogged fuel filter may restrict fuel flow, further exacerbating the issue. Furthermore, the idle air control valve plays a significant role in maintaining a steady idle speed, and any malfunction here can lead to erratic engine behavior. Lastly, a malfunctioning throttle body can hinder air intake, resulting in an uneven idle. By systematically checking these components, you can effectively troubleshoot and resolve the rough idle issue, ensuring your E400 runs smoothly.
